Trump's Political Shift: Exploring Third-Party Options

A Look Back at Trump's Political Aspirations
In a notable interview from 1999, Donald Trump expressed his frustrations with the Republican Party's direction, suggesting that neither major party represented the voices of many Americans. He contemplated the Reform Party, indicating an interest in alternatives beyond the traditional two-party system.
Trump's Critique of Mainstream Politics
During a CNN interview, Trump articulated his discontent with both the Republican and Democratic parties. He claimed that both sides were too extreme, failing to address the core concerns of citizens. Trump emphasized a need for a unifying national spirit that he believed was missing from the current political dialogue.
The Possibility of a Third Party
When pressed about the potential of a third party, Trump replied, "Maybe we have no choice." He acknowledged the formidable challenges facing the Reform Party but remained open to exploring this option. His willingness to consider a third-party candidacy demonstrated a desire for change in the political arena.
The Reform Party's Mission
The Reform Party, founded by Ross Perot in 1992, sought to create a viable alternative to America's established political framework. Despite initial traction, Trump's engagement with the party was short-lived as he withdrew his presidential exploratory committee in March 2000.

Trump's Recent Comments on Third-Party Politics
Recently, Trump took to social media to critique Musk's plans for the America Party, labeling it a "Train Wreck" and asserting that the American political system is not equipped to handle third-party dynamics. His comments highlight the ongoing friction between traditional political norms and the rise of new organizational structures.
